        Least Favorite: The crowd reactions and atmosphere need improvement
        Ditto. Like you said, it's not a game killer or anything, but what makes it particularly annoying is how spot-on some of the reactions are, while for others it might as well be a game from 10 years ago. Throwing a second strike to a batter when you're in a jam is a perfect example: they cheer at exactly the right time at exactly the right volume. Then you strike the guy out and the reaction is quieter than it was for that second strike. ... So close yet so far.

        A close second for least favorite is how easy it is to hit your spots when pitching. I want to be able to have a few games here and there of hitting all my spots, but just as frequently I want my pitchers to have moments (say a stretch of an inning or two) of serious control problems.

        My favorite thing about the game is probably the graphics. My god they're beautiful. If only it had a better fielding cam to highlight the stadiums.
